Understanding Boulder's Climate and Its Impact on Patio Furniture

Boulder's climate presents specific challenges for outdoor furniture. The area experiences significant temperature fluctuations, intense sunlight, and occasional heavy snowfall. These conditions can degrade certain materials over time, leading to fading, cracking, or rusting. Therefore, selecting furniture made from weather-resistant materials is crucial for ensuring its durability and longevity in Boulder's environment.

Materials like teak, aluminum, and high-density polyethylene (HDPE) are well-suited for Boulder's climate. Teak, a naturally oily hardwood, is resistant to moisture and insects. Aluminum is lightweight and rustproof, making it a practical choice for furniture that needs to be moved easily. HDPE, a recycled plastic material, is highly durable and resistant to fading, cracking, and splintering. These materials offer a balance of aesthetic appeal and resilience, ensuring that patio furniture can withstand the rigors of Boulder's weather.

Furthermore, considering the furniture's finish is essential. Powder coating on metal furniture provides an additional layer of protection against rust and corrosion. UV-resistant coatings on fabrics and plastics help to prevent fading and degradation from prolonged sun exposure. Paying attention to these details can significantly extend the lifespan of patio furniture in Boulder.

Key Considerations When Choosing Patio Furniture in Boulder

Selecting the right patio furniture involves more than just material selection. Several factors play a crucial role in creating a functional and aesthetically pleasing outdoor space. These include the available space, the intended use of the patio, the desired style, and the budget.

Space Availability:

Before purchasing any furniture, accurately measure the patio area. This will help determine the appropriate size and configuration of the furniture. For smaller patios, consider space-saving options such as folding chairs or bistro sets. For larger patios, sectionals, dining sets, and lounge chairs can be arranged to create distinct zones for relaxation, dining, and entertaining.

Intended Use:

Determine how the patio will primarily be used. If the patio is mainly for dining, a dining table and chairs are essential. If it's for relaxation and lounging, consider comfortable seating options such as lounge chairs, sofas, and ottomans. If the patio is used for entertaining, ensure there is ample seating and consider adding features like outdoor bars or fire pits.

Style and Aesthetics:

Patio furniture should complement the overall style of the home and landscape. Consider the architectural style of the house, the color palette of the exterior, and the surrounding landscape. Options range from modern and minimalist designs to rustic and traditional styles. Choosing furniture that harmonizes with the existing environment will create a cohesive and visually appealing outdoor space.

Budget:

Patio furniture can range in price from affordable to high-end. Set a budget before beginning the shopping process and stick to it. Consider investing in high-quality pieces that will last for many years, rather than opting for cheaper options that may need to be replaced frequently. Look for sales and discounts, and consider purchasing furniture during the off-season to save money.

Beyond these core considerations, accessories play a significant role in enhancing the comfort and style of the patio. Outdoor rugs can define spaces and add warmth, while cushions and pillows provide comfort and visual appeal. Umbrellas and shade structures offer protection from the sun. Incorporating these elements can transform a patio into a welcoming and functional outdoor living space.

Material Options for Patio Furniture in Boulder: Durability and Aesthetics

The material used in patio furniture significantly impacts its durability, maintenance requirements, and aesthetic appeal. Understanding the properties of different materials is crucial for making informed decisions.

Teak:

As previously mentioned, teak is a naturally durable hardwood that is highly resistant to moisture, insects, and decay. It requires minimal maintenance and can last for many years. Teak develops a beautiful silver-gray patina over time, adding to its aesthetic appeal. While teak can be more expensive than other materials, its longevity and durability make it a worthwhile investment.

Aluminum:

Aluminum is a lightweight and rustproof metal that is ideal for patio furniture. It is easy to move and maintain. Aluminum furniture is often powder-coated to provide additional protection against the elements and to add color. Aluminum can be combined with other materials, such as wicker or fabric, to create a variety of styles.

Wicker:

Wicker refers to the weaving process rather than a specific material. Traditionally, wicker was made from natural materials such as rattan or bamboo. However, modern wicker furniture is often made from synthetic materials such as resin or polyethylene. Synthetic wicker is more durable and weather-resistant than natural wicker, making it a better choice for outdoor use in Boulder. It is available in a wide range of colors and styles and is relatively easy to clean.

High-Density Polyethylene (HDPE):

HDPE is a recycled plastic material that is highly durable and resistant to fading, cracking, and splintering. It is a sustainable option that is also low-maintenance. HDPE furniture is available in a variety of colors and styles and is often designed to mimic the look of wood or wicker. It is a practical and eco-friendly choice for patio furniture in Boulder.

Iron and Steel:

Iron and steel are strong and durable materials that can add a sense of elegance and sophistication to a patio. However, they are susceptible to rust and require regular maintenance. Iron and steel furniture should be powder-coated to provide protection against the elements. Additionally, these materials can be quite heavy, making them difficult to move. Stainless steel is a more rust-resistant option, but it can be more expensive.

Fabric:

Outdoor fabrics play a crucial role in the comfort and aesthetic appeal of patio furniture. Choose fabrics that are specifically designed for outdoor use, such as solution-dyed acrylic or polyester. These fabrics are resistant to fading, mildew, and water damage. Consider the color and pattern of the fabric to complement the overall style of the patio. Cushion and pillow covers should be removable and washable for easy cleaning.

Maintaining Patio Furniture in Boulder for Longevity

Proper maintenance is essential for extending the lifespan of patio furniture and keeping it looking its best. The specific maintenance requirements will vary depending on the materials used, but some general guidelines apply to most types of patio furniture.

Regular cleaning is crucial for removing dirt, dust, and debris. Use a mild soap and water solution to clean the furniture regularly. Avoid using harsh chemicals or abrasive cleaners, as these can damage the finish. Rinse the furniture thoroughly with water and allow it to air dry. For stubborn stains, consider using a specialized cleaner designed for the specific material.

Protecting the furniture from the elements is also important. When not in use, cover the furniture with protective covers to shield it from sun, rain, and snow. Store cushions and pillows indoors during inclement weather to prevent them from getting wet or damaged. Consider storing the furniture indoors during the winter months, especially if it is made from materials that are particularly vulnerable to cold temperatures.

Addressing repairs promptly can prevent small problems from becoming big ones. Tighten loose screws and bolts regularly to ensure the furniture is stable. Repair any cracks or chips in the finish to prevent further damage. Replace worn or damaged cushions and pillows to maintain comfort and aesthetic appeal.

Specific materials may require additional maintenance. Teak furniture can be oiled periodically to maintain its natural color, although many people prefer to let it develop its natural silver-gray patina. Aluminum furniture may need to be re-powder-coated if the finish becomes chipped or damaged. Wicker furniture should be cleaned regularly to prevent dirt from accumulating in the crevices. Iron and steel furniture should be inspected regularly for rust and treated with a rust inhibitor as needed. Fabrics should be cleaned and treated with a water repellent to protect them from stains and moisture.

By following these maintenance tips, homeowners in Boulder can keep their patio furniture looking beautiful and functioning properly for many years, maximizing their investment and enjoying their outdoor living spaces to the fullest.
